package net.sf.jeasyorm;
import java.sql.Connection;
import java.sql.DatabaseMetaData;
import java.sql.PreparedStatement;
import java.sql.ResultSet;
import java.sql.SQLException;
import java.sql.Types;
import java.util.ArrayList;
import java.util.List;
public class DerbyEntityManager extends BasicEntityManager {
private boolean pagingSupported = false;
public DerbyEntityManager(Connection connection) throws SQLException {
super(connection);
DatabaseMetaData metadata = connection.getMetaData();
String prodName = metadata.getDatabaseProductName();
if (prodName.indexOf("Derby") < 0) throw new RuntimeException("Database not supported");
int majorVersion = metadata.getDatabaseMajorVersion();
int minorVersion = metadata.getDatabaseMinorVersion();
if (majorVersion > 10 || (majorVersion == 10 && minorVersion >= 5)) pagingSupported = true;
}
@SuppressWarnings("unchecked")
public <T> Page<T> find(Class<T> entityClass, int pageNum, int pageSize, String query, Object... params) {
if (!pagingSupported) throw new UnsupportedOperationException();
boolean isNative = Utils.isNativeType(entityClass);
SqlInfo info = isNative ? null : getSqlInfo(this, entityClass);
String sql = isNative ? query : getSql(info, query);
List<T> entities = new ArrayList<T>();
PreparedStatement stmt = null;
try {
String pagingSql = sql + " offset " + (pageNum*pageSize) + " rows fetch next " + pageSize + " rows only";
stmt = prepareStatement(pagingSql, null);
for (int i=0; i<params.length; i++) {
setParameter(stmt, i+1, params[i], Types.VARCHAR);
}
ResultSet rs = null;
try {
rs = stmt.executeQuery();
while (rs.next()) {
T entity = !isNative ? (T) getObject(rs, info.mapping) : (T) getValue(rs, 1, entityClass, Types.VARCHAR);
entities.add(entity);
}
int totalSize = (pageNum*pageSize) + entities.size();
if (entities.size() >= pageSize) {
totalSize = Math.max(totalSize, count(sql, params));
}
return new Page<T>(entities, pageNum, pageSize, totalSize);
} catch (RuntimeSQLException se) {
throw se;
} catch (Exception e) {
throw new RuntimeSQLException("Error executing statement [" + sql + "]", e);
} finally {
close(rs);
}
} finally {
close(stmt);
}
}
}
